Oscar: trionfano i Coen tra le candidature
oscar2.jpg

Saranno quattro le possibilità per l’Italia di aggiudicarsi un Oscar 2008. Archiviata la delusione per la mancata nomination de La Sconosciuta di Giuseppe Tornatore, i portabandiera del tricolore nazionale saranno due musicisti, Dario Marianelli autore della colonna sonora di Espiazione, già premiato con il Golden Globe e Marco Beltrami, ormai americanizzato, per il film Quel treno per Yuma. Soddisfazione per Andrea Jublin, nominato per il cortometraggio Il Supplente prodotto da Sky Cinema Italia. In gara per la migliore scenografia ci saranno Dante Ferretti e Francesca Lo Schiavo per il loro lavoro in Sweeney Todd di Tim Burton. Ben 8 nomination per l’ultimo lavoro dei fratelli Coen, Non è un paese per vecchi, che concorre fra gli altri come miglior film, regia, sceneggiatura, fotografia e montaggio. Sorprendono positivamente le 4 nomination per Juno di Jason Reitman, già vincitore della Festa del Cinema di Roma (miglior film, regia, sceneggiatura originale e miglior attrice). L’impegno di George Clooney è stato invece ricompensato con 6 nomination, nonostante il suo Michael Clayton non abbia impressionato la giuria all’ultima Mostra del Cinema di Venezia.

Espiazione conferma le 7 nomination ricevute anche ai Golden Globe. Infine 4 nomination per Lo scafandro e la farfalla, passato con successo all’ultimo Festival di Cannes e Il petroliere di Paul Thomas Anderson.
La premiazione, ammesso che lo sciopero degli sceneggiatori non riesca a bloccarla come accaduto per i Golden Globe, si terrà come tradizione al Kodak Theater di Hollywood, nella notte di domenica 24 febbraio.

Ecco l’elenco completo delle nomination:

Miglior Film
ESPIAZIONE - "Atonement" (Focus Features) A Working Title Production: Tim Bevan, Eric Fellner and Paul Webster, Producers
JUNO - "Juno" (Fox Searchlight) A Dancing Elk Pictures, LLC Production: Lianne Halfon, Mason Novick and Russell Smith, Producers
MICHAEL CLAYTON - "Michael Clayton" (Warner Bros.) A Clayton Productions, LLC Production: Sydney Pollack, Jennifer Fox and Kerry Orent, Producers
NON E’ UN PAESE PER VECCHI - "No Country for Old Men" (Miramax and Paramount Vantage) A Scott Rudin/Mike Zoss Production: Scott Rudin, Ethan Coen and Joel Coen, Producers
IL PETROLIERE - "There Will Be Blood" (Paramount Vantage and Miramax) A JoAnne Sellar/Ghoulardi Film Company Production: JoAnne Sellar, Paul Thomas Anderson and Daniel Lupi, Producers

Miglior Regia
LO SCAFANDRO E LA FARFALLA - "The Diving Bell and the Butterfly" (Miramax/Pathé Renn), Julian Schnabel
JUNO - "Juno" (Fox Searchlight), Jason Reitman
MICHAEL CLAYTON - "Michael Clayton" (Warner Bros.), Tony Gilroy
NON E’ UN PAESE PER VECCHI - "No Country for Old Men" (Miramax and Paramount Vantage), Joel Coen and Ethan Coen
IL PETROLIERE - "There Will Be Blood" (Paramount Vantage and Miramax), Paul Thomas Anderson

Miglior Film Straniero
"Beaufort" Israel
"The Counterfeiters" Austria
"Katyn" Poland
"Mongol" Kazakhstan
"12" Russia

Migliore Sceneggiatura Non Originale
ESPIAZIONE - "Atonement" (Focus Features), Screenplay by Christopher Hampton
LONTANO DA LEI - "Away from Her" (Lionsgate), Written by Sarah Polley
LO SCAFANDRO E LA FARFALLA - "The Diving Bell and the Butterfly" (Miramax/Pathé Renn), Screenplay by Ronald Harwood
NON E’ UN PAESE PER VECCHI - "No Country for Old Men" (Miramax and Paramount Vantage), Written for the screen by Joel Coen & Ethan Coen
IL PETROLIERE - "There Will Be Blood" (Paramount Vantage and Miramax), Written for the screen by Paul Thomas Anderson

Migliore Sceneggiatura Originale
JUNO - "Juno" (Fox Searchlight), Written by Diablo Cody
"Lars and the Real Girl" (MGM), Written by Nancy Oliver
MICHAEL CLAYTON - "Michael Clayton" (Warner Bros.), Written by Tony Gilroy
RATATOUILLE - "Ratatouille" (Walt Disney), Screenplay by Brad Bird; Story by Jan Pinkava, Jim Capobianco, Brad Bird
LA FAMIGLIA SAVAGE - "The Savages" (Fox Searchlight), Written by Tamara Jenkins

Migliore Attore Protagonista
George Clooney in "Michael Clayton" (Warner Bros.)
Daniel Day-Lewis in "There Will Be Blood" (Paramount Vantage and Miramax)
Johnny Depp in "Sweeney Todd The Demon Barber of Fleet Street" (DreamWorks and Warner Bros., Distributed by DreamWorks/Paramount)
Tommy Lee Jones in "In the Valley of Elah" (Warner Independent)
Viggo Mortensen in "Eastern Promises" (Focus Features)

Miglior Attore Non Protagonista
Casey Affleck in "The Assassination of Jesse James by the Coward Robert Ford" (Warner Bros.)
Javier Bardem in "No Country for Old Men" (Miramax and Paramount Vantage)
Philip Seymour Hoffman in "Charlie Wilson's War" (Universal)
Hal Holbrook in "Into the Wild" (Paramount Vantage and River Road Entertainment)
Tom Wilkinson in "Michael Clayton" (Warner Bros.)

Miglior Attrice Protagonista
Cate Blanchett in "Elizabeth: The Golden Age" (Universal)
Julie Christie in "Away from Her" (Lionsgate)
Marion Cotillard in "La Vie en Rose" (Picturehouse)
Laura Linney in "The Savages" (Fox Searchlight)
Ellen Page in "Juno" (Fox Searchlight)

Migliore Attrice Non Protagonista
Cate Blanchett in "I'm Not There" (The Weinstein Company)
Ruby Dee in "American Gangster" (Universal)
Saoirse Ronan in "Atonement" (Focus Features)
Amy Ryan in "Gone Baby Gone" (Miramax)
Tilda Swinton in "Michael Clayton" (Warner Bros.)

Miglior Film Animato
PERSEPOLIS - "Persepolis" (Sony Pictures Classics): Marjane Satrapi and Vincent Paronnaud
RATATUILLE - "Ratatouille" (Walt Disney): Brad Bird
SURF’S UP - "Surf's Up" (Sony Pictures Releasing): Ash Brannon and Chris Buck

Miglior Scenografia
AMERICAN GANGSTER - "American Gangster" (Universal): Art Direction: Arthur Max; Set Decoration: Beth A. Rubino
ESPIAZIONE - "Atonement" (Focus Features): Art Direction: Sarah Greenwood; Set Decoration: Katie Spencer
LA BUSSOLA D’ORO - "The Golden Compass" (New Line in association with Ingenious Film Partners): Art Direction: Dennis Gassner; Set Decoration: Anna Pinnock
SWEENEY TODD - "Sweeney Todd The Demon Barber of Fleet Street" (DreamWorks and Warner Bros., Distributed by DreamWorks/Paramount): Art Direction: Dante Ferretti; Set Decoration: Francesca Lo Schiavo
IL PETROLIERE - "There Will Be Blood" (Paramount Vantage and Miramax): Art Direction: Jack Fisk; Set Decoration: Jim Erickson

Miglior Fotografia
L’ASSASSIONIO DI JESSE JAMES - "The Assassination of Jesse James by the Coward Robert Ford" (Warner Bros.): Roger Deakins
ESPIAZIONE - "Atonement" (Focus Features): Seamus McGarvey
LO SCAFANDRO E LA FARFALLA - "The Diving Bell and the Butterfly" (Miramax/Pathé Renn): Janusz Kaminski
NON E’ UN PAESE PER VECCHI - "No Country for Old Men" (Miramax and Paramount Vantage): Roger Deakins
IL PETROLIERE - "There Will Be Blood" (Paramount Vantage and Miramax): Robert Elswit

Migliori Costumi
ACROSS THE UNIVERSE - "Across the Universe" (Sony Pictures Releasing) Albert Wolsky
ESPIAZIONE - "Atonement" (Focus Features) Jacqueline Durran
ELIZABETH: THE GOLDEN AGE - "Elizabeth: The Golden Age" (Universal) Alexandra Byrne
LA VIE EN ROSE - "La Vie en Rose" (Picturehouse) Marit Allen
SWEENEY TODD - "Sweeney Todd The Demon Barber of Fleet Street" (DreamWorks and Warner Bros., Distributed by DreamWorks/Paramount) Colleen Atwood

Miglior Documentario
"No End in Sight" (Magnolia Pictures) A Representational Pictures Production: Charles Ferguson and Audrey Marrs
"Operation Homecoming: Writing the Wartime Experience" (The Documentary Group) A Documentary Group Production: Richard E. Robbins
"Sicko" (Lionsgate and The Weinstein Company) A Dog Eat Dog Films Production: Michael Moore and Meghan O'Hara
"Taxi to the Dark Side" (THINKFilm) An X-Ray Production: Alex Gibney and Eva Orner
"War/Dance" (THINKFilm) A Shine Global and Fine Films Production: Andrea Nix Fine and Sean Fine

Miglior Corto Documentario
"Freeheld" A Lieutenant Films Production: Cynthia Wade and Vanessa Roth
"La Corona (The Crown)" A Runaway Films and Vega Films Production: Amanda Micheli and Isabel Vega
"Salim Baba" A Ropa Vieja Films and Paradox Smoke Production: Tim Sternberg and Francisco Bello
"Sari's Mother" (Cinema Guild) A Daylight Factory Production: James Longley

Miglior Montaggio
THE BOURNE ULTIMATUM - "The Bourne Ultimatum" (Universal): Christopher Rouse
LO SCAFANDRO E LA FARFALLA - "The Diving Bell and the Butterfly" (Miramax/Pathé Renn): Juliette Welfling
INTO THE WILD - "Into the Wild" (Paramount Vantage and River Road Entertainment): Jay Cassidy
NON E’ UN PAESE PER VECCHI - "No Country for Old Men" (Miramax and Paramount Vantage) Roderick Jaynes
IL PETROLIERE - "There Will Be Blood" (Paramount Vantage and Miramax): Dylan Tichenor

Miglior Trucco
LA VIE EN ROSE - "La Vie en Rose" (Picturehouse) Didier Lavergne and Jan Archibald
NORBIT - "Norbit" (DreamWorks, Distributed by Paramount): Rick Baker and Kazuhiro Tsuji
I PIRATI DEI CARAIBI – LA FINE DEL MONDO - "Pirates of the Caribbean: At World's End" (Walt Disney): Ve Neill and Martin Samuel

Migliore Colonna Sonora
ESPIAZIONE - "Atonement" (Focus Features) Dario Marianelli
IL CACCIATORE DI AQUILONI - "The Kite Runner" (DreamWorks, Sidney Kimmel Entertainment and Participant Productions, Distributed by Paramount Classics): Alberto Iglesias
MICHAEL CLAYTON - "Michael Clayton" (Warner Bros.) James Newton Howard
RATATUILLE - "Ratatouille" (Walt Disney) Michael Giacchino
QUEL TRENO PER YUMA - "3:10 to Yuma" (Lionsgate) Marco Beltrami

Miglior Canzone Originale
"Falling Slowly" from "Once" (Fox Searchlight) Music and Lyric by Glen Hansard and: Marketa Irglova
"Happy Working Song" from "Enchanted" (Walt Disney): Music by Alan Menken; Lyric by Stephen Schwartz
"Raise It Up" from "August Rush" (Warner Bros.): Nominees to be determined
"So Close" from "Enchanted" (Walt Disney): Music by Alan Menken; Lyric by Stephen Schwartz
"That's How You Know" from "Enchanted" (Walt Disney): Music by Alan Menken; Lyric by Stephen Schwartz

Miglior Corto Animato
"I Met the Walrus" A Kids & Explosions Production: Josh Raskin
"Madame Tutli-Putli" (National Film Board of Canada) A National Film Board of Canada Production Chris Lavis and Maciek Szczerbowski "Même Les Pigeons Vont au Paradis (Even Pigeons Go to Heaven)" (Premium Films) A BUF Compagnie Production Samuel Tourneux and Simon Vanesse
"My Love (Moya Lyubov)" (Channel One Russia) A Dago-Film Studio, Channel One Russia and Dentsu Tec Production Alexander Petrov
"Peter & the Wolf" (BreakThru Films) A BreakThru Films/Se-ma-for Studios Production Suzie Templeton and Hugh Welchman

Miglior Corto
"At Night" A Zentropa Entertainments 10 Production: Christian E. Christiansen and Louise Vesth
"Il Supplente (The Substitute)" (Sky Cinema Italia) A Frame by Frame Italia Production: Andrea Jublin
"Le Mozart des Pickpockets (The Mozart of Pickpockets)" (Premium Films) A Karé Production: Philippe Pollet-Villard
"Tanghi Argentini" (Premium Films) An Another Dimension of an Idea Production: Guido Thys and Anja Daelemans
"The Tonto Woman" A Knucklehead, Little Mo and Rose Hackney Barber Production: Daniel Barber and Matthew Brown

Miglior Montaggio Sonoro
THE BOURNE ULTIMATUM - "The Bourne Ultimatum" (Universal): Karen Baker Landers and Per Hallberg
NON E’ UN PAESE PER VECCHI - "No Country for Old Men" (Miramax and Paramount Vantage): Skip Lievsay
RATATUILLE - "Ratatouille" (Walt Disney): Randy Thom and Michael Silvers
IL PETROLIERE - "There Will Be Blood" (Paramount Vantage and Miramax): Matthew Wood
TRANSFORMERS - "Transformers" (DreamWorks and Paramount in association with Hasbro): Ethan Van der Ryn and Mike Hopkins

Miglior Mix Sonoro
THE BOURNE ULTIMATUM - "The Bourne Ultimatum" (Universal) Scott Millan, David Parker and Kirk Francis
NON E’ UN PAESE PER VECCHI - "No Country for Old Men" (Miramax and Paramount Vantage): Skip Lievsay, Craig Berkey, Greg Orloff and Peter Kurland
RATATUILLE - "Ratatouille" (Walt Disney): Randy Thom, Michael Semanick and Doc Kane
QUEL TRENO PER YUMA - "3:10 to Yuma" (Lionsgate): Paul Massey, David Giammarco and Jim Stuebe
TRANSFORMERS - "Transformers" (DreamWorks and Paramount in association with Hasbro): Kevin O'Connell, Greg P. Russell and Peter J. Devlin

Migliori Effetti Visivi
LA BUSSOLA D’ORO - "The Golden Compass" (New Line in association with Ingenious Film Partners): Michael Fink, Bill Westenhofer, Ben Morris and Trevor Wood
I PIRATI DEI CARAIBI – LA FINE DEL MONDO - "Pirates of the Caribbean: At World's End" (Walt Disney): John Knoll, Hal Hickel, Charles Gibson and John Frazier
TRANSFORMERS - "Transformers" (DreamWorks and Paramount in association with Hasbro): Scott Farrar, Scott Benza, Russell Earl and John Frazier
